(RJF) is trading at $151.46, up 0.69% in the latest session. The stock remains above its support level of $143.89 while approaching a key resistance zone near $159.03. Recent price action suggests a cautiously positive tone as the financial sector continues to digest interest rate expectations and broader market trends.
